Three fans · Nigeria, Yoruba · ID: 3034274
Description
metal alloy, disc-shaped, decorated with incised ornaments resp. punched zoomorphic forms, min. dam., slight traces of abrasion, metal socle;
used in the cult of the river goddess “oshun”, who bestows the gift of children. The cult has spread over practically the whole of Yorubaland, but is centred on the city of Oshogbo. The frightening thing about Oshun is that she uses her fans not only as means of keeping cool, but also as throwing knives which she flings at those who arouse her anger.
